Eligibility
Inclusion criteria
Inclusion criteria: Inclusion Criteria: 18-45 years; BMI = 35; regular menstrual cycles (21-35day) and Regular bleeding (3-10days) in the latest three menses; moderate and severe dysmenorrhea (grade 2,3) based on Multidimensional Verbal Scoring System; rejection of Secondary dysmenorrhea by history and pelvic ultrasound; no History of pelvic or abdominal surgery; not taking other medications; no history of allergy to ginger; no history of bleeding disease; no history of gallstone. Exclusion Criteria: pregnancy; sensitivity to medication during the study; avoiding the correct use of medication; taking another drug that is not defined in the study; patients with Possible serious side effects; patients who need additional interventions and surgery; patients who decide to be excluded.

Design outcomes
Primary
| Measure | Time frame |
|---|---|
| Pain intensity. Timepoint: cycle before intervention, every cycles during intervention (3 cycles). Method of measurement: VAS = visual analog scale.;Pain duration. Timepoint: cycle before intervention, every cycles during intervention (3 cycles). Method of measurement: hour. | — |
Secondary
| Measure | Time frame |
|---|---|
| Side effect: Stomachache, nasea, vomiting, hematemesis, belch, fatigue, itching, acne, heartburn, diarrhea, constipation, melena,headache, drowsiness, redness, assessment of bleeding with PBAC. Timepoint: cycle before intervention, every cycle during intervention (3 cycles). Method of measurement: questionnaire.;Mefenamic asid use. Timepoint: cycle before intervention, every cycle during intervention (3 cycles). Method of measurement: number. | — |
